Parapsychology is the scientific study of phenomena that appear to transcend the normal boundaries of psychology and physics, such as extrasensory perception (ESP), telepathy, and psychokinesis. Students pursue parapsychology for various reasons: some are interested in the intersection of psychology and unexplained phenomena, others want to understand research methodology in studying controversial topics, and many are drawn to careers in psychology, neuroscience, or research that explore the limits of human consciousness.
Parapsychology presents unique challenges because it requires students to balance scientific rigor with open-mindedness toward phenomena that mainstream science often dismisses. Students struggle with understanding experimental design and statistical analysis needed to evaluate parapsychological claims, distinguishing between credible research and pseudoscience, and grappling with the philosophical implications of findings that challenge conventional understanding. Parapsychology courses usually cover the history of psychical research, experimental methods and statistical analysis, specific phenomena like ESP and remote viewing, theories of consciousness, neuroscience foundations, and evaluation of parapsychological evidence. Students also learn about famous experiments (like those conducted at Duke University), the role of skepticism in science, and how to critically assess research claims.
